In today’s fragmented media landscape, dominated by digital channels and fleeting trends, it’s easy to overlook the enduring power of traditional marketing. Yet, for brands seeking to genuinely connect with Hispanic consumers, neglecting these time-tested channels would be a grave oversight. Television, radio, print, and out-of-home advertising continue to hold significant sway within the Hispanic community, offering unique avenues to build brand awareness, foster trust, and reach diverse audiences.
This guide delves into the persistent influence of traditional marketing on Hispanic consumers and provides actionable strategies for maximizing your brand’s impact.
Why Traditional Marketing Remains Relevant in a Digital World
While digital marketing offers undeniable advantages, traditional channels provide distinct benefits that remain crucial in the modern marketing landscape:
- Unmatched Reach: Traditional media, particularly television and radio, cast a wide net, reaching audiences who may not be as active online or have limited digital access. This is particularly important when considering older generations within the Hispanic community, who often rely more heavily on traditional media for news and entertainment. In fact, according to Nielsen, Spanish-language television networks frequently outperform English-language networks in primetime ratings among Hispanic viewers, demonstrating the enduring power of this medium. - Trusted Sources: Many Hispanic consumers have long-standing relationships with traditional media outlets, particularly Spanish-language television and radio stations. These outlets often serve as trusted sources of information and cultural connection, enhancing the credibility of brand messages delivered through these channels. Building trust is paramount in any marketing strategy, and traditional media provides a solid foundation for establishing that connection.
- Cultural Resonance: Spanish-language programming often reflects the values, traditions, and humor that resonate deeply with Hispanic audiences. This creates a receptive environment for brand messaging, allowing your campaigns to seamlessly integrate into a culturally relevant context. By aligning your brand with the cultural nuances of your target audience, you can create a stronger emotional connection and build lasting relationships.
- Emotional Connection: Traditional media formats, especially television and radio, have a unique ability to evoke strong emotions and create memorable brand experiences. A well-crafted television commercial or radio jingle can leave a lasting impression, fostering a deeper connection with your brand. This emotional resonance can be far more impactful than a fleeting online ad.
Television: A Cultural Pillar in Hispanic Households
Television continues to be a cornerstone of entertainment and information within many Hispanic households. As mentioned earlier, Nielsen reports that Spanish-language networks often outperform English-language networks in primetime ratings among Hispanic viewers. This underscores the strong affinity Hispanic consumers have for Spanish-language television, making it a prime channel for building brand awareness and driving engagement.

To maximize your impact on television, consider:
- Strategic Placement: Invest in advertising on popular Spanish-language networks like Univision, Telemundo, and Azteca America, ensuring your message reaches a broad and engaged audience.
- Culturally Resonant Storytelling: Craft commercials that reflect the values, traditions, and humor that resonate with Hispanic viewers. Showcase diverse families, celebrate Hispanic heritage, and tell authentic stories that connect on an emotional level.
- Content Integration: Explore opportunities to sponsor or partner with Spanish-language television shows and programs that align with your brand values and target audience. This can provide a more organic and less intrusive way to reach your audience.
Radio: The Soundtrack of Hispanic Life
Radio remains a constant companion for many Hispanic consumers, providing a soundtrack to their daily lives. Whether commuting to work, running errands, or relaxing at home, radio offers a consistent presence and a sense of community. Nielsen data shows that Spanish-language radio reaches 83% of Hispanic adults weekly, highlighting its pervasive reach and influence.

To effectively leverage radio, consider:
- Targeted Advertising: Place ads on popular Spanish-language radio stations that cater to your specific target audience, ensuring your message reaches the right listeners.
- Engaging Audio Content: Develop radio spots that are catchy, memorable, and culturally relevant. Utilize music, humor, and authentic voices to capture attention and create a lasting impression.
- Program Sponsorship: Align your brand with popular radio personalities or programs that resonate with Hispanic listeners, building credibility and trust through association.
Print Media: Maintaining its Relevance in a Digital Age
While digital media has undeniably disrupted the publishing industry, Hispanic-focused newspapers and magazines continue to hold a special place within the community. These publications offer a trusted source of information, cultural connection, and targeted reach. According to our Hispanic Media Explorerâ„¢, there are over 800 Hispanic-focused publications in the U.S., demonstrating the continued importance of this medium. Furthermore, 62% of Hispanic adults read Hispanic-focused publications monthly, highlighting the consistent engagement with this traditional format.

To effectively utilize print media, consider:
- Strategic Placement: Place ads in Hispanic publications that align with your target audience and brand values.
- Culturally Relevant Design: Develop visually appealing ads that resonate with Hispanic aesthetics and cultural sensibilities.
- Community Partnerships: Collaborate with Hispanic publications on events or initiatives that support the community, demonstrating your commitment to social responsibility.
Out-of-Home and Experiential Marketing: Connecting in the Real World
Out-of-home advertising, with its ability to reach consumers in their daily environments, offers a powerful way to connect with Hispanic consumers. Billboards, transit ads, and street furniture can capture attention and reinforce brand messaging within Hispanic communities. Strategically placing these ads in areas with high concentrations of Hispanic residents ensures maximum visibility and impact.
Experiential marketing, which involves creating immersive and engaging experiences, allows brands to connect with Hispanic consumers on a personal level. Sponsoring cultural events, hosting interactive activations, and partnering with Hispanic organizations can create lasting memories and foster deeper connections. These experiences provide an opportunity to engage with your audience on a more personal level, building brand loyalty and advocacy.
By strategically incorporating these traditional marketing channels into your overall marketing plan, you can effectively reach a diverse range of Hispanic consumers, build brand awareness, foster trust, and drive meaningful engagement.
